Experience the opportunity to support students as a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) in a dynamic school setting located near San Francisco, CA. This contract assignment offers two temporary openings working on-site, providing essential coverage during maternity leaves. The work schedule is full-time, at 37.5 hours per week, beginning August 5, 2026. The precise duration and caseload details will be confirmed as additional supervisory information becomes available later in July.

Your expertise and leadership as a BCBA will significantly impact student outcomes by executing high-quality behavioral interventions and collaborating closely with educators and families.

Qualifications:

  • Current and valid California credential with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) authorization
  • Proven school-based experience preferred
  • Strong collaborative skills with multidisciplinary teams
  • Ability to create, implement, and monitor behavior intervention plans
  • Excellent communication, reporting, and documentation abilities

Role Responsibilities:

  • Provide direct behavioral consultation and support to students and staff
  • Assess students for behavioral needs, develop individualized intervention plans, and monitor progress
  • Collaborate with teachers, aides, and support personnel to reinforce positive behavior supports in the classroom
  • Conduct regular meetings and trainings for staff on behavioral best practices
  • Maintain accurate documentation and timely reporting following school and district protocols
  • Engage proactively with families, caregivers, and additional service providers
